Transaction eac4a354909758f14871c4ac07d14649d315ad88aa248c6825f2518c1a6a3abf
1 Input
1 Output
-
eac4a354909758f14871c4ac07d14649d315ad88aa248c6825f2518c1a6a3abf:0
- value
- 10708130
- script pubkey
- OP_0 OP_PUSHBYTES_20 36589bf93f6d66025f31469573241172f1e860f0
- address
- bc1qxevfh7fld4nqyhe3g62hxfq3wtc7sc8spe2khp